Download presentation
Presentation is loading. Please wait.
1
1 Memory Systems Virtual Memory Lecture 25 Digital Design and Computer Architecture Harris & Harris Morgan Kaufmann / Elsevier, 2007
2
2 But First…
3
3 The Memory Hierarchy
4
4 The Hard Disk
5
5 Virtual Memory Overview Physical Memory acts as a cache for virtual memory. Page table maps virtual pages to physical pages. This mapping of virtual addresses to physical addresses is called address translation. Translation Lookaside Buffers (TLBs) speed up address translation.
6
6 Virtual and Physical Addresses
7
7 Cache/Virtual Memory Analogues CacheVirtual Memory BlockPage Block SizePage Size Block OffsetPage Offset MissPage Fault Tag Virtual Page Number
8
8 Virtual Address Translation
9
9
10
10 The Page Table
11
11 Replacement Policies
12
12 Translation Lookaside Buffer (TLB)
13
13 Example TLB
14
14 Virtual Memory
15
15 Memory System Summary
Similar presentations
© 2024 SlidePlayer.com. Inc.
All rights reserved.